gpt4 book ai didi

java - DynamoDB 的映射器是否支持查询自动生成的 key ?

转载 作者:行者123 更新时间:2023-12-02 13:09:03 25 4
gpt4 key购买 nike

这篇关于适用于 Java 的 AWS 开发工具包的文章表示,它可以通过 @DynamoDBAutoGenerateKey 自动生成数据类中的 key : https://aws.amazon.com/articles/0802321832592496

问题是,如何根据该 key 加载类似的内容?如果我使用该 ID 构造一个对象并用它调用 .load(),它会自动查找正确的哈希值吗?

最佳答案

没错。

例如使用映射器:

DynamoDBMapperConfig mapperConfig = DynamoDBMapperConfig
.builder()
.withTableNameOverride(DynamoDBMapperConfig.TableNameOverride.withTableNamePrefix(environment + "."))
.withConversionSchema(ConversionSchemas.V2)
.build();

client.getMapper().load(DBActivity.class, id, mapperConfig)

其中,id 是自动生成的 key 。

关于java - DynamoDB 的映射器是否支持查询自动生成的 key ?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44036960/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com